ホームページ  >  記事  >  コンピューターのチュートリアル  >  HTTPリクエストの内部サーバーエラーを解決する

HTTPリクエストの内部サーバーエラーを解決する

王林
王林オリジナル
2024-02-18 09:51:061194ブラウズ

http リクエスト エラー: サーバー内部エラーの解決策

インターネットの発展に伴い、HTTP プロトコルは現代のインターネット通信の標準になりました。 HTTP リクエストは、Web ブラウジング、モバイル アプリケーション、API インターフェイスなどのさまざまなシナリオで一般的な対話方法です。ただし、HTTP リクエストを開始すると、「サーバー内部エラー」というエラー メッセージが表示されることがあります。このエラー メッセージは通常、サーバーで内部エラーが発生し、リクエストを正常に処理できなかったことを意味します。では、この問題に遭遇した場合、どのように解決すればよいのでしょうか?

まず、「サーバー内部エラー」の考えられる原因を理解する必要があります。このエラーは通常、サーバー側の問題によって発生します。次のような理由が考えられます。

  1. サーバー プログラム エラー: サーバー側プログラムには、リクエストの処理を妨げるバグまたはロジック エラーがある可能性があります。通常は。これには、開発者がサーバー プログラムをデバッグして修復する必要があります。
  2. サーバー リソースが不十分です: サーバーは、高負荷またはリソース不足のため、リクエストを処理できない可能性があります。現時点では、サーバーのハードウェアリソースを増やすか、サーバー構成を最適化することで問題を解決できます。
  3. ネットワーク接続の問題: ネットワーク接続が不安定または故障しているため、サーバーと正常に通信できない可能性があります。この時点で、問題を解決するためにネットワークに再接続するか、ネットワーク環境を変更してみることができます。

これらの考えられる理由のため、ここではいくつかの推奨される解決策を示します:

  1. サーバー側プログラムを確認してください: サーバー コードとログ情報がある場合は、サーバー側のプログラムを報告できます。情報に従ってエラーを確認し、問題を特定します。サーバー側プログラムのデバッグと修復を試してください。サードパーティが提供するサービス インターフェイスを使用している場合は、サービス プロバイダーに問い合わせてサポートを求めることができます。
  2. サーバー リソースを増やす: サーバー リソースを管理する権限がある場合は、サーバーの CPU、メモリ、ディスク、その他のハードウェア リソースを増やすことを検討できます。さらに、サーバー プログラムの構成を最適化すると、サーバーのパフォーマンスも向上します。
  3. ネットワーク接続を確認します: 特定のネットワーク環境でこのエラーが発生した場合は、他のネットワーク環境を使用して問題が引き続き発生するかどうかをテストできます。ネットワーク接続の問題が原因である場合は、ネットワーク サービス プロバイダーに問い合わせてください。

上記の方法に加えて、いくつかの一般的な解決策があります:

  1. サーバーを再起動します: サーバーに一時的な問題が発生する場合があります。サーバーを再起動すると内部エラーが解決される場合があります。問題が原因です。
  2. キャッシュの使用: リクエストが頻繁に発生する場合は、サーバーへの高負荷リクエストを回避するためにキャッシュの使用を検討してください。キャッシュすることでサーバーの負荷が軽減され、応答速度が向上します。
  3. 開発者およびサービス プロバイダーに連絡する: 問題を解決できない場合は、開発者またはサービス プロバイダーに連絡して、詳細なエラー情報と操作手順を提供してください。通常、より専門的なソリューションを提供できます。

要約すると、HTTP リクエスト エラー「サーバー内部エラー」が発生した場合、まず問題の原因がサーバーにあるのかどうかを判断する必要があります。次に、サーバー側プログラムの確認、サーバー リソースの増加、ネットワーク接続の調整など、考えられる原因に基づいて対応する解決策を実行します。これらの方法でも問題が解決しない場合は、サーバーの再起動、キャッシュの使用など、他の一般的な解決策を講じることができます。最後に、他のすべてが失敗した場合は、開発者またはサービスプロバイダーに連絡して専門家の助けを求めることができます。

今日のインターネット時代では、HTTP リクエストは私たちの日常の仕事や生活に欠かせない部分になっています。 HTTP リクエストの一般的なエラー解決方法を理解し、習得することは、さまざまなネットワーク インタラクションの問題をより適切に処理し、作業効率とエクスペリエンスの質を向上させるのに役立ちます。したがって、「サーバー内部エラー」のようなエラーが発生した場合でも、パニックにならずに上記の解決策に従って、順序立てて問題を解決してください。

以上がHTTPリクエストの内部サーバーエラーを解決するの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。